Senior Accountant — Client-Facing Specialist in QuickBooks OnlineAbout Us

T&M Business Advisors & Consulting CPAs is a dynamic accountancy firm serving a diverse clientele across Los Angeles, Ventura, Riverside, and San Bernardino Counties. We deliver tailored solutions in GAAP accounting, taxation, business advisory, and advanced financial reporting. Our client roster spans a wide range of industries, which means understanding industry-specific transaction flows and business models is at the heart of what we do.

Job Overview

We are seeking a proactive, detail-driven Senior Accountant who is passionate about understanding businesses from the inside out. In this client-facing role, you’ll partner directly with business owners and management teams, lead the onboarding process, unravel transaction types, and ensure our clients’ accounting accurately reflects their operations and compliance needs.

The ideal candidate is a QuickBooks Online expert, adept with complex journal entries, streamlined onboarding, and full-cycle accounting. You should be comfortable working independently, mentoring junior accountants, and serving as the bridge between our internal CPA leadership and our clients’ day-to-day accounting realities.

Key Responsibilities

Lead and manage client onboarding in QuickBooks Online: chart of accounts setup, historical data imports, and process mapping tailored to each client’s business model.
Analyze and document client business operations to ensure industry-appropriate categorization of revenue, costs, and intercompany transfers.
Prepare, review, and maintain general ledgers, journal entries, and all core financial statements (balance sheet, income statement, cash flow).
Conduct advanced reconciliations of bank accounts, credit cards, and balance sheet accounts to resolve discrepancies.
Oversee accounts payable/receivable and full double-entry bookkeeping for multiple entities.
Collaborate with clients to clarify the nature and intent of transactions and adjust entries as needed for accuracy and compliance.
Supervise and provide technical mentorship to junior accountants, reviewing journal entries, reconciliations, and staff-prepared tax returns.
Identify workflow improvements and champion best practices for process automation and data accuracy within our QuickBooks Online environment.
Stay current with industry, regulatory, and software updates impacting small business accounting.
Qualifications

Education: Bachelor’s in Accounting, Finance, or a related field required; CPA, EA, or advanced certification strongly preferred.
Experience: At least 5 years of hands-on accounting experience, ideally in public accounting or professional services, with clear evidence of multi-industry exposure.
Technical Proficiency: Deep expertise in QuickBooks Online (client onboarding, custom reporting, advanced reconciliations, setup of rules and automations). Strong Excel/Google Sheets skills required.
Analytical Skills: Exceptional capability to interpret business operations, spot misclassifications, and recommend structural improvements in client books.
Soft Skills: Strong client communication, documentation, leadership, and mentorship abilities.
Process Mindset: Experience developing, refining, and enforcing accounting SOPs and quality controls.
